Transaction 7942e6819f3134dd67d70203c12dd3d7c9a622e160a1352d0fe43c7e8097ffac
1 Input
1 Output
-
7942e6819f3134dd67d70203c12dd3d7c9a622e160a1352d0fe43c7e8097ffac:0
- value
- 25048089
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f69899e91731d5fe71d0c3afa290e3099504969 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Etp2y83LK4zqXAWuoLTUcK67bcYFtcLX